Understanding Car Locksmith Services
A car locksmith is a customized locksmith who focuses on automotive locks and keys. They are geared up to manage a wide variety of issues, from basic key duplications to intricate electronic key programming. Mobile car locksmith professionals, in particular, are specialists who can concern your location, whether you are at home, work, or on the side of the road, to provide immediate assistance.
Solutions Offered by Car Locksmiths
Key Duplication
Standard Keys: If you need an additional key for your vehicle, a car locksmith can quickly duplicate your existing key.Remote Keys: For lorries with keyless entry systems, car locksmiths can program and duplicate remote keys, guaranteeing you can open and start your car without problems.
Lockout Assistance
** unlocking Doors **: If you've locked your keys in the car, a mobile car locksmith can securely unlock your vehicle without causing damage to the locks or the vehicle itself.Ignition Lockout: For situations where you can't start your car since the key is stuck in the ignition, a car locksmith can help extract it.
Key Replacement
Lost Keys: If you've lost your car key, a locksmith can create a new one utilizing the vehicle's V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) or a spare key.Broken Keys: If your key is harmed or broken, a locksmith can replace it and ensure the brand-new key works effortlessly with your car.
Transponder Key Programming
New Keys: Many modern cars featured transponder keys, which require programming to the car's onboard computer. An expert car locksmith can program a brand-new transponder key to ensure it functions correctly.Reprogramming: If your transponder key has actually stopped working, a locksmith can reprogram it to restore its performance.
Lock Installation and Repair
New Locks: If your car's locks are broken or harmed, a car locksmith can set up new, high-quality locks.Lock Repair: For small concerns like sticking or jammed locks, a locksmith can repair them to guarantee smooth operation.
Security Upgrades
High-Security Locks: For added comfort, a car locksmith can set up high-security locks that are more resistant to tampering and theft.Immobilizer Systems: These innovative security systems prevent your car from starting if the correct key is not present. Q1: Can a mobile car locksmith aid if I lock my keys in the car?
A1: Yes, a mobile car locksmith can safely open your car without causing any damage. They are geared up with tools and techniques to handle various lockout circumstances.
Q2: How much does it cost to get a new car key made?
A2: The expense can vary depending on the type of key and the complexity of the vehicle's lock system. Requirement keys can cost anywhere from ₤ 20 to ₤ 50, while remote and transponder keys can v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150 or more.
Q3: Can a locksmith program a new transponder key?
A3: Yes, an expert car locksmith can program a new transponder key to your vehicle's onboard computer system. This is a typical service for contemporary vehicles that require this kind of key.
Q4: What should I do if my car key breaks inside the lock?
A4: If your key breaks inside the lock, do not attempt to require it out. Instead, call a mobile car locksmith who can securely extract the broken key and provide a replacement if needed.
Q5: How can I prevent being locked out of my car?
A5: Keep a spare key in a safe place, such as a trusted good friend's house or a safe key box. Frequently inspect your car locks for wear and tear and have them serviced by a professional locksmith.
